Ordinals
beta
Sat 1547026416854197
decimal
408810.1416854197
degree
0°198810′1578″1416854197‴
percentile
73.66792469313937%
name
cwuyxkbclfw
cycle
0
epoch
1
period
202
block
408810
offset
1416854197
timestamp
2016-04-25 03:42:24 UTC
rarity
common
prev
next